Pyrex Everywhere at Value Village

Hello Everyone, SixBalloons here! We were out of town last weekend in Victoria, BC and we thrifted it up, starting at a huge Value Village.

There I found several pieces of Pyrex, including an Opal Divided Dish, Shenedoah Casserole with lid, and dishwashered Terra casserole.


There were also several glass pitchers and carafes.


There was also a huge pile of Pyrex restaurant-ware in the red and gold trim.
